Legal Ombudsman, R (on the application of) v Young

Legal Ombudsman, R (on the application of) v Young

The court proceeds on the basis of undertakings by the defendant to cooperate with the Ombudsman, search for and locate relevant files, and keep contact details updated. The matter is adjourned for review, with costs awarded to the claimant.

  1. 1 Whether the court should enquire into the Ombudsman's application
  2. 2 Whether the defendant should be dealt with for failure to comply with a section 147 notice
  3. 3 How the court should deal with the defendant's non-compliance

Ratio Decidendi

The court proceeds on the basis of undertakings by the defendant to cooperate with the Ombudsman, search for and locate relevant files, and keep contact details updated. The matter is adjourned for review, with costs awarded to the claimant.

Court Disposition

Application adjourned; undertakings recorded; costs awarded to claimant; liberty to apply granted to both parties.

Orders

  • Defendant to take all reasonable steps to search for and locate but not take possession of all outstanding files and documents referred to in the section 147 notice dated 14 January 2011.
  • Defendant to cooperate with and assist the claimant in investigating Mr and Mrs Weston's complaint and any other complaint made about the defendant to the Ombudsman.
